«compiling» 태그된 질문

일반적으로 "make"명령을 사용하여 소스에서 소프트웨어를 컴파일하는 것과 관련된 질문입니다.

5
Vim을 컴파일 할 때 터미널 라이브러리를 찾을 수 없습니다
우분투 12.04를 실행 중입니다. vim 작업을 위해 특정 플러그인을 얻으려고하는데 vim에 루비 지원이 활성화되어 있어야합니다 (플러그인은 command-t입니다). 사람들은 내 vim 디렉토리로 가서 실행해야한다고 말합니다. ./configure --enable-rubyinterp 이 작업을 수행하면 다음 오류가 발생합니다. no terminal library found checking for tgetent()... configure: error: NOT FOUND! You need to install a terminal library; …

2
패키지를 빌드하는 데 사용 된 구성 옵션은 어디에서 찾을 수 있습니까?
우분투 10.10에 별표 1.6.2.18을 설치해야합니다 별표 1.6.2.7의 우분투 패키지를 생성하는 데 사용 된 구성 옵션이 무엇인지 알고 싶습니다. 내가 가장 좋아하는 서버 배포판은 Slackware이며 Slackbuild 파일을 참조하여 패키지를 만들고 새로운 소스로 다시 만들 수 있도록 사용자 정의 할 수있는 방법을 알지만 우분투에서이를 알아낼 수는 없습니다. 나는 지금 시간 압력을 받고 …



4
실제로 apt-get install을 통해 패키지를 어떻게 설치합니까?
이 apt-get install방법을 사용하여 패키지를 우분투에 설치하는 경우 해당 패키지의 소스 코드를 얻는 것과 처음부터 빌드하는 것 사이에 근본적인 차이가 있습니까? 이 apt-get install기능은 단순히 소스를 다운로드하여 컴퓨터에서 지정된 디렉토리로 빌드 합니까, 아니면 더 많은 장면이 있습니까? 마지막으로 (아마 대답이 없을 수도 있습니다) 한 방법이 다른 방법보다 낫습니까? 내가 여기에서 …

1
구성 해결 방법 : 오류 : readline 라이브러리를 찾을 수 없습니까?
postgres를 컴파일하려는 최소 설치로 Ubuntu 10.04 LTS 서버가 있습니다. 최소한의 설치로 서버에 gcc가 없으므로 수행해야 apt-get install gcc했지만 이제 postgres 에서이 오류가 계속 발생합니다 ./configure. configure: error: readline library not found readline 라이브러리가 포함 된 패키지 이름을 찾을 수 없습니다. 두 가지 질문이 있습니다. readline을 포함하는 패키지의 이름은 무엇입니까? 표준 …
27 apt  compiling 

4
실시간 커널을 어떻게 설치합니까?
비슷한 질문으로 많은 스레드를 읽었지만 답변을 읽은 후에는 매우 혼란스러워합니다. 나는 그들에게 리포지토리가있는 많은 URL을 발견했지만 사람들은 하나 또는 두 개의 우분투 버전에 대해 어떤 리포지토리가 만들어지는 지에 대해 이야기하지만 11.10 버전에 대해서는 아무것도 찾지 못했습니다. 너무 빨리 요청하지 않습니까? 실시간 커널을 갖도록 우분투를 다운 그레이드해야합니까?


3
소스에서 설치된 패키지를 모두 빌드하는 방법은 무엇입니까?
이 질문은 Ask Ubuntu에서 답변을 얻을 수 있기 때문에 Stack Overflow에서 마이그레이션 되었습니다. 8 년 전에 이주했습니다 . 젠투와 같은 소스 기반 리눅스 배포판이 우분투와 같은 사전 구축 배포판과 비교할 때 특정 시스템에 최적화 된 소스로 설치하기 때문에 어떻게 성능이 크게 향상 될 수 있는지에 대해 읽었습니다. 동일한 종류의 혜택을 …
26 compiling 


1
bfd.h에 우분투 14.04에 libiberty / ansidecl.h가 포함되어 있어야합니까?
binutils 패키지 libiberty.h가로 이동 한 디렉토리가 포함되어 있기 때문에 변경된 것으로 보입니다 /usr/include/libiberty. 따라서 bfd.h관련에 잘못된 포함이있을 수 있습니다 ansidecl.h. binutils 추적 유틸리티를 사용할 때 컴파일 오류 얻기 /usr/include/libiberty/libiberty.h: In function ‘basename’: /usr/include/libiberty/libiberty.h:110:38: error: expected declaration specifiers before ‘ATTRIBUTE_RETURNS_NONNULL’ extern char *basename (const char *) ATTRIBUTE_RETURNS_NONNULL ATTRIBUTE_NONNULL(1); ^ /usr/include/libiberty/libiberty.h:121:45: error: …

2
64 비트 시스템에서 32 비트 커널 컴파일
32 비트 단일 코어 Intel Atom 컴퓨터 용 커널을 컴파일하려고합니다. 말할 것도없이, 컴파일은 많은 시간이 걸립니다. 2 시간 동안 진행되었으며 여전히 드라이버 모듈의 중간 정도입니다. 메인 데스크탑에서 커널을 컴파일하는 데 15 분 밖에 걸리지 않지만 64 비트 시스템입니다. 더 나은 머신에서 32 비트 커널 패키지를 생성하기 위해 크로스 컴파일을 할 …


1
g ++에서 C ++ 11을 어떻게 사용합니까?
현재 gedit에 모든 코드를 입력하고 터미널을 사용하여 프로그램을 컴파일하고 있습니다. 그렇게하려면 다음을 입력하십시오. $ g++ main.cpp -o main $ ./main 그리고 이것은 효과가 있습니다. 그러나 C ++ 11을 사용하지 않습니다. C ++ 버전을 확인하고 C ++ 11을 사용하여 터미널을 통해 컴파일하는 방법은 무엇입니까?

2
소스 코드를 사용할 수없는 동적 실행 파일에서 정적을 만드는 오픈 소스 방법이 있습니까?
예를 들어 문제를 설명하겠습니다. 나는 xfig 및 pdfedit 와 같은 일상적인 작업에서 오래된 프로그램을 사용 합니다. 이제이 프로그램은 상당히 오래되었으며 너무 자주 업데이트되지 않습니다. 내 두려움은 언젠가는 라이브러리가 없거나 호환되지 않는 업데이트로 인해 더 이상 작동하지 않을 것입니다. 실행중인 시스템 에서 프로그램을 지금 쉽게 컴파일 할 수 있다면 해결책이 편리합니다. …

당사 사이트를 사용함과 동시에 당사의 쿠키 정책개인정보 보호정책을 읽고 이해하였음을 인정하는 것으로 간주합니다.
Licensed under cc by-sa 3.0 with attribution required.